The Structure of the Norwegian Driver's License
Norway, as a member of the European Economic Area (EEA), concerns driver's licenses that comply with standardized European Union formats. An authentic Norwegian driver's license is a plastic, credit-card-style file featuring innovative security features, including holograms, laser inscription, and tactile elements to avoid counterfeiting.
The license is categorized into various classes depending on the type of vehicle the holder is authorized to drive.

Obtaining a Class B (basic vehicle) license in Norway is an extensive procedure managed by the Norwegian Public Roads Administration (Statens vegvesen). It needs a substantial financial investment of both time and funds, showing Norway's commitment to developing safe and proficient motorists.
Here are the mandatory steps every learner must complete:
- Traffic Basic Course (Trafikalt grunnkurs):
- Mandatory for all newbie applicants under the age of 25.
- Covers fundamental first aid, driving in the dark (mørkekjøring), and basic traffic theory.
- Theory Test (Teoritentamen):
- Can be taken as soon as the fundamental course is finished.
- A computer-based multiple-choice examination taken at a Statens vegvesen station.
- Practical Driving Lessons:
- While private practice with an approved manager is allowed, trainees should take a series of mandatory lessons with a qualified traffic school (trafikkskole).
- Mandatory steps consist of action examinations, security courses on practice tracks (glattkjøring), and long-distance driving.
- The Practical Driving Test (Praktisk prøve):
- An extensive road test evaluated by an official sensor from the general public Roads Administration.
- Tests the driver's capability to navigate intricate traffic, perform maneuvers safely, and show independent decision-making.
Transforming a Foreign License to a Norwegian One
For people transferring to Norway with a license released outside the EEA, the rules regarding conversion can be complex. Norway has particular contracts with particular nations, while others require the applicant to retake parts of the screening process.
- EEA Licenses: If the license was provided in an EU/EEA member state, it is normally valid in Norway till its expiration date. Holders can frequently drive on their home country's license or exchange it for Norsk Førerkort Til Salgs a Norwegian one without taking brand-new tests.
- Approved Third-Country Licenses: Citizens from countries with reciprocal agreements (such as particular US states, Canada, or Australia) may exchange their license for a Norwegian one, offered they use within a specific timeframe after moving (typically within 3 months) and pass a useful driving test.
- Non-Approved Licenses: Individuals from nations outside these arrangements should complete the entire Norwegian licensing process from scratch-- including the basic course, theory test, and useful exam.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. For how long is a Norwegian chauffeur's license legitimate?
For standard lorry classes (A and B), the license is typically legitimate till the holder turns 70 years old. After age 70, renewals require a medical certificate (legeattest). Nevertheless, the physical card itself need to generally be restored every 15 years to upgrade the photograph and individual information.
2. Can I drive in Norway with a foreign license?
Yes, visitors and brand-new citizens can temporarily drive in Norway utilizing a legitimate foreign chauffeur's license or an International Driving Permit (IDP). However, long-term citizens moving to Norway must eventually convert their license to a Norwegian one depending on their nation of origin.
3. What takes place if I lose my Norwegian motorist's license?
If your license is lost, taken, or damaged, you need to purchase a replacement card through the "Your Page" (Din side) portal on the official Statens vegvesen website. You might be required to send a new passport-sized photo if your existing digital profile image is outdated.
4. Is the theory test offered in English?
Yes. When reserving your theory test through the Norwegian Public Roads Administration, you can choose to take the examination in either Norwegian or English.
